NATA score College predictor My daughter Score 113 in OBC NCM female category from Andhrapadesh. Predict her college.

Sunanda Dhar Student Expert 4th Jul, 2019

Your admission through NATA is based on your merit system. Divide the NATA score by 4, and your CBSE result by 2, and add them to find your merit out of 100. Normally colleges accept a student who has 60+ merit overall, and sometimes colleges even go for lower merit.
